Space and Comfort
The Armada is a full-size SUV, which translates to ample space for passengers and cargo. If you've got a growing family, frequently carpool, or simply need room for hauling gear, the Armada delivers. The Platinum trim takes the comfort factor up a notch with features like leather upholstery, heated and cooled front seats, and a rear-seat entertainment system. Imagine those long road trips with the kids – they'll be thanking you for the built-in DVD player!
Power and Capability
Under the hood, you'll typically find a robust V8 engine that provides plenty of power for towing and hauling. Whether you're pulling a boat to the lake or simply navigating challenging terrain, the Armada is up to the task. Four-wheel-drive versions offer even greater capability for those who live in areas with snow or off-road adventures.
Premium Features
The Platinum trim is the top-of-the-line Armada, meaning it comes loaded with features. Expect to find things like a premium sound system, navigation system, adaptive cruise control, blind-spot monitoring, and a 360-degree camera system. These features not only enhance the driving experience but also add an extra layer of safety and convenience.

What to Look for When Inspecting a Used Armada Platinum
Once you've found a few potential candidates, it's time to get up close and personal. Here's what to look for when inspecting a used Armada Platinum:
Vehicle History Report
Before you even see the vehicle in person, obtain a vehicle history report from companies like Carfax or AutoCheck. This report will reveal important information about the vehicle's past, such as accidents, title issues, and odometer readings. Avoid vehicles with salvage titles or major accident damage.
Exterior Condition
Carefully examine the exterior of the Armada for any signs of damage, such as dents, scratches, or rust. Pay close attention to the paint, looking for mismatched colors or signs of repainting. Check the tires for wear and tear, and make sure the wheels are in good condition.
Interior Condition
Step inside and inspect the interior for wear and tear. Check the seats for rips, stains, or excessive wear. Test all the electronic features, such as the infotainment system, climate control, and power windows. Make sure everything is working properly.
Mechanical Condition
This is where a pre-purchase inspection by a trusted mechanic is crucial. The mechanic can assess the engine, transmission, brakes, suspension, and other critical components. They can identify any potential problems and provide you with an estimate of repair costs.
Test Drive
Never buy a used car without taking it for a test drive. Pay attention to how the vehicle handles, accelerates, and brakes. Listen for any unusual noises or vibrations. Test the four-wheel-drive system (if applicable) to make sure it's functioning properly.
Negotiating the Price
Okay, you've found a used Armada Platinum that you like, and it's passed your inspection. Now it's time to negotiate the price. Here are some tips to help you get the best deal:
Research Market Value
Before you make an offer, research the market value of similar vehicles in your area. Use online tools like Kelley Blue Book (KBB) and Edmunds to get an idea of what a fair price is.
Be Prepared to Walk Away
Don't be afraid to walk away from the deal if the seller is unwilling to negotiate. There are plenty of other used Armadas out there, and you don't want to overpay.
Point Out Any Flaws
If you found any flaws during your inspection, use them as leverage to negotiate a lower price. For example, if the tires are worn, you can ask the seller to replace them or reduce the price accordingly.
Consider Financing Options
If you're financing the purchase, shop around for the best interest rates. Credit unions and online lenders often offer more competitive rates than dealerships.
